Mass Gaming Commission releases Sept. revenue statement16 October 2015(PRESS RELEASE) -- The Massachusetts Gaming Commission (MGC) reported today that the month of September 2015 at Plainridge Park Casino has generated $12,625,157.80 in Gross Gaming Revenue (GGR). The category 2 slots-parlor is taxed on 49% of gross gaming revenue, of that total taxed amount 82% is paid to Local Aid and 18% goes to the Race Horse Development Fund. To date, the state has collected $25,552,014.57 in total state taxes and race horse assessments from Plainridge Park Casino since its June 24, 2015 opening. MONTH: September Slot GGR: $12,625,157.80 Slot Promotional: $1,250,316.69 Coin in: $146,996,787.00 Hold %: 8.52% Payout %: 91.48% Total collected state taxes and race horse assessments: $6,186,327.32 MGC will continue to post monthly revenue reports to its website MassGaming.com. The information will be available in the Revenue section and posted approximately the 15th of each month. |
